Ingredients for Deliciously Irresistible Cranberry Orange Muffins You Must Bake Now!
Gathering the right ingredients is the first step to creating these delightful muffins. Here’s what you’ll need:
- All-purpose flour: This is the base of your muffins, providing structure and a soft texture.
- Fresh cranberries: Tart and juicy, they add a burst of flavor. You can also use frozen cranberries if fresh ones aren’t available.
- Granulated sugar: This sweetens the muffins and balances the tartness of the cranberries. Adjust the amount for your desired sweetness.
- Orange juice: Freshly squeezed is best, as it enhances the orange flavor and keeps the muffins moist.
- Unsalted butter: Melted butter adds richness and helps create a tender crumb. You can substitute with coconut oil for a dairy-free option.
- Large egg: This binds the ingredients together and adds moisture. For a vegan alternative, use a flax egg.
- Orange zest: The zest brings a vibrant citrus aroma and flavor, elevating the muffins to a whole new level.
- Baking powder: This leavening agent helps the muffins rise, giving them a light and fluffy texture.
- Baking soda: It works with the acidic ingredients to create a perfect rise and helps balance the flavors.
- Salt: Just a pinch enhances all the flavors and balances the sweetness.

How to Make Deliciously Irresistible Cranberry Orange Muffins You Must Bake Now!
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Start by preheating your oven to 375°F (190°C). This step is crucial for achieving that perfect rise and golden color. While the oven warms up, line your muffin tin with paper liners. This makes for easy cleanup and helps the muffins release effortlessly after baking.
Step 2: Mix Dry Ingredients
In a large b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, granulated sugar,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. This combination creates a light and fluffy texture. Make sure there are no lumps, as this will ensure even distribution of the leavening agents throughout your muffins.
Step 3: Combine Wet Ingredients
In another bowl, mix the melted butter, orange juice, egg, and orange zest until well combined. The melted butter should be warm but not hot, as this helps blend the ingredients smoothly. This mixture will add moisture and flavor to your muffins, making them irresistibly delicious!
Step 4: Combine Wet and Dry Mixtures
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and stir gently until just combined. Be careful not to overmix; a few lumps are perfectly fine! Now, fold in the chopped cranberries, ensuring they’re evenly distributed throughout the batter for that delightful burst of flavor in every bite.
Step 5: Fill Muffin Cups
Divide the batter evenly among the muffin cups, filling each about two-thirds full. This allows room for the muffins to rise without overflowing. If you overfill, you might end up with a messy oven and muffins that don’t bake evenly. Trust me, it’s worth the caution!
Step 6: Bake the Muffins
Bake your muffins in the preheated oven for 18-20 minutes. To check for doneness, insert a toothpick into the center of a muffin. If it comes out clean or with a few crumbs, they’re ready! Keep an eye on them, as oven temperatures can vary.
Step 7: Cool and Serve
Once baked, allow the muffins to cool in the pan for about 5 minutes. Then, transfer them to a wire rack to cool completely. This step is essential for achieving the perfect texture. Serve them warm or at room temperature, and watch your family devour them!

FAQs about Deliciously Irresistible Cranberry Orange Muffins You Must Bake Now!
Can I use frozen cranberries instead of fresh?
Absolutely! Frozen cranberries can be used in a pinch. Just make sure to chop them while still frozen to prevent them from clumping together in the batter.
How do I store leftover muffins?
To keep your muffins fresh, store them in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. For longer storage, freeze them in a zip-top bag for up to three months.
Can I make these muffins ahead of time?
Yes! You can prepare the batter the night before and store it in the fridge. Just give it a gentle stir before filling the muffin cups and baking in the morning.
What can I substitute for the egg?
If you need an egg substitute, a flax egg works wonderfully! Just mix one tablespoon of ground flaxseed with three tablespoons of water and let it sit for a few minutes until it thickens.
How can I make these muffins less sweet?
If you prefer a less sweet muffin, simply reduce the sugar to 1/3 cup. The tartness of the cranberries will still shine through beautifully!

Deliciously Irresistible Cranberry Orange Muffins You’ll Love!
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 20 minutes
- Total Time: 35 minutes
- Yield: 12 muffins 1x
- Category: Breakfast
- Method: Baking
- Cuisine: American
- Diet: Vegetarian
Description
These cranberry orange muffins are a delightful combination of tart cranberries and sweet orange zest, perfect for breakfast or a snack.
Ingredients
- 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up fresh cranberries, chopped
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 1/2 cup orange juice
- 1/4 cup unsalted butter, melted
- 1 large egg
- 1 tablespoon orange zest
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C) and line a muffin tin with paper liners.
- In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
- In another bowl, mix the melted butter, orange juice, egg, and orange zest until well combined.
-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and stir until just combined. Fold in the chopped cranberries.
- Divide the batter evenly among the muffin cups, filling each about 2/3 full.
- Bake for 18-20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
- Allow to cool in the pan for 5 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
Notes
- For a sweeter muffin, increase the sugar to 3/4 cup.
- These muffins can be frozen for up to 3 months.
- Feel free to add nuts or chocolate chips for extra flavor.
